This specimen was lot 2148 in Goldberg sale 128 (Los Angeles, June 2022), where it sold for $720. The catalog description[1] noted, "Russia. Poltina (½ Rouble), 1765-СПБ ЯI. Catherine II. Toned. PCGS graded AU-53." Poltinas, or half rubles, were struck throughout Catherine's reign. This particular style was struck 1764-65 and is quite expensive in nice condition. This example sold for less than half the catalog value.

Recorded mintage: 332,000 (assayers ЯI and CA).

Specification: 12 g, 0.750 fine silver.

Catalog reference: KM-C66.2a, Bit-276.
